How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hurst?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Hurst Studio Apartments | $1,532 | $1,150 | $2,169 |
Hurst 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,368 | $794 | $3,579 |
Hurst 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,783 | $985 | $4,370 |
Hurst 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,407 | $1,257 | $5,549 |
Hurst 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,405 | $2,275 | $8,277 |
